Output 68ef433a41a9c134cc93e7efaee5e5d82aafedc736143d75a7a6b5f892c5999e:2

value
23336907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59531f9280de1f639c61333b5e4b00dd649a1e5 OP_EQUAL
address
3JF8xXgfhB1GaUTgAQUAd5NG7BpS9o9QjF
transaction
68ef433a41a9c134cc93e7efaee5e5d82aafedc736143d75a7a6b5f892c5999e
spent
true